BBB Foods, Inc. Class A Earnings Call Summary

Earnings Call Date:May 06, 2026
(Q1-2026)
|
% Change Since: |
Next Earnings Date:Aug 26, 2026
Earnings Call Sentiment Positive
The call conveyed a strongly positive operating performance: high revenue growth (+33% YoY), robust same-store sales (+16%), rapid net store expansion (123 net openings this quarter; LTM 580, +20% YoY), strong adjusted EBITDA growth (+39%) and notably higher operating cash flow (+64%). Management emphasized self-funded growth supported by negative working capital and continued investments in distribution centers, IT/AI and talent. Key challenges highlighted were the sizable non-cash share-based compensation that materially reduces reported EBITDA, some expense pressures (utilities, permitting, D&A), gross margin volatility, labor/regulatory exposures, and ongoing ERP implementation risks. Overall, the positives (scale, growth, cash generation, margin expansion excluding non-cash charges, strong unit economics and pilot successes) materially outweigh the lowlights, which are mainly execution and non-cash accounting or regulatory risks.

Company Guidance
The management reiterated growth and capital guidance centered on continued store expansion and self‑funding, citing 123 net new stores in Q1 (3,469 total stores; 580 LTM net openings, +20% vs Mar‑2025) and 20 active distribution centers, with same‑store sales up 16% and revenue rising 33% YoY to 23.0 billion pesos; reported EBITDA was 554 million pesos (adjusted EBITDA excluding non‑cash share‑based payments rose 39% to 1.3 billion pesos, with adjusted EBITDA margin +22 bps), operating cash flow reached 2.0 billion pesos (+64% YoY), adjusted negative working capital totaled 9.4 billion pesos (≈11.3% of LTM revenue, vs 6.5 billion in 2025, excluding IPO proceeds), selling expenses were 10.3% of revenue (+5 bps), and annual CapEx was guided at ~5.2 billion pesos; management noted share‑based payments are non‑cash (details in the appendix), the lockup expires August 6, the ERP is a three‑year program about halfway deployed, and while no formal SG&A guidance was given, G&A should be roughly stable this year and decline as a percentage of revenue over the long term.

BBB Foods, Inc. Class A Financial Statement Overview

Summary
Cash flow is a key strength (strong TTM operating cash flow and solid, improving free cash flow), but this is offset by deteriorating profitability (TTM net loss, negative operating profit, thin ~16% gross margin) and a pressured balance sheet with elevated leverage (~3.4x debt-to-equity) and weak recent ROE.
